mirror of
https://github.com/CaiJimmy/hugo-theme-stack.git
synced 2025-04-29 12:03:31 +08:00
Move [data-scheme=dark] back to :root block
This commit is contained in:
parent
b7e197964f
commit
93eca2587b
@ -1,6 +1,18 @@
|
|||||||
$defaultTagBackgrounds: #8ea885, #df7988, #0177b8, #ffb900, #6b69d6;
|
$defaultTagBackgrounds: #8ea885, #df7988, #0177b8, #ffb900, #6b69d6;
|
||||||
$defaultTagColors: #fff, #fff, #fff, #fff, #fff;
|
$defaultTagColors: #fff, #fff, #fff, #fff, #fff;
|
||||||
|
|
||||||
|
[data-scheme="light"] {
|
||||||
|
--pre-text-color: #272822;
|
||||||
|
--pre-background-color: #fafafa;
|
||||||
|
@import "partials/highlight/light.scss";
|
||||||
|
}
|
||||||
|
|
||||||
|
[data-scheme="dark"] {
|
||||||
|
--pre-text-color: #f8f8f2;
|
||||||
|
--pre-background-color: #272822;
|
||||||
|
@import "partials/highlight/dark.scss";
|
||||||
|
}
|
||||||
|
|
||||||
/*
|
/*
|
||||||
* Global style
|
* Global style
|
||||||
*/
|
*/
|
||||||
@ -26,9 +38,19 @@ $defaultTagColors: #fff, #fff, #fff, #fff, #fff;
|
|||||||
|
|
||||||
--scrollbar-thumb: hsl(0, 0%, 85%);
|
--scrollbar-thumb: hsl(0, 0%, 85%);
|
||||||
--scrollbar-track: var(--body-background);
|
--scrollbar-track: var(--body-background);
|
||||||
|
|
||||||
|
&[data-scheme="dark"] {
|
||||||
|
--body-background: #303030;
|
||||||
|
--accent-color: #ecf0f1;
|
||||||
|
--accent-color-darker: #bdc3c7;
|
||||||
|
--accent-color-text: #000;
|
||||||
|
--body-text-color: rgba(255, 255, 255, 0.7);
|
||||||
|
--scrollbar-thumb: #424242;
|
||||||
|
--scrollbar-track: var(--body-background);
|
||||||
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
/*
|
/**
|
||||||
* Global font family
|
* Global font family
|
||||||
*/
|
*/
|
||||||
:root {
|
:root {
|
||||||
@ -68,9 +90,18 @@ $defaultTagColors: #fff, #fff, #fff, #fff, #fff;
|
|||||||
@include respond(md) {
|
@include respond(md) {
|
||||||
--small-card-padding: 25px;
|
--small-card-padding: 25px;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
&[data-scheme="dark"] {
|
||||||
|
--card-background: #424242;
|
||||||
|
--card-background-selected: rgba(255, 255, 255, 0.16);
|
||||||
|
--card-text-color-main: rgba(255, 255, 255, 0.9);
|
||||||
|
--card-text-color-secondary: rgba(255, 255, 255, 0.7);
|
||||||
|
--card-text-color-tertiary: rgba(255, 255, 255, 0.5);
|
||||||
|
--card-separator-color: rgba(255, 255, 255, 0.12);
|
||||||
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
/*
|
/**
|
||||||
* Article content font settings
|
* Article content font settings
|
||||||
*/
|
*/
|
||||||
:root {
|
:root {
|
||||||
@ -105,6 +136,16 @@ $defaultTagColors: #fff, #fff, #fff, #fff, #fff;
|
|||||||
|
|
||||||
--table-border-color: #dadada;
|
--table-border-color: #dadada;
|
||||||
--tr-even-background-color: #efefee;
|
--tr-even-background-color: #efefee;
|
||||||
|
|
||||||
|
&[data-scheme="dark"] {
|
||||||
|
--code-background-color: #272822;
|
||||||
|
--code-text-color: rgba(255, 255, 255, 0.9);
|
||||||
|
|
||||||
|
--table-border-color: #717171;
|
||||||
|
--tr-even-background-color: #545454;
|
||||||
|
|
||||||
|
--blockquote-background-color: rgb(75 75 75);
|
||||||
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
/*
|
/*
|
||||||
@ -118,47 +159,3 @@ $defaultTagColors: #fff, #fff, #fff, #fff, #fff;
|
|||||||
--shadow-l4: 0px 24px 32px rgba(0, 0, 0, 0.04), 0px 16px 24px rgba(0, 0, 0, 0.04), 0px 4px 8px rgba(0, 0, 0, 0.04),
|
--shadow-l4: 0px 24px 32px rgba(0, 0, 0, 0.04), 0px 16px 24px rgba(0, 0, 0, 0.04), 0px 4px 8px rgba(0, 0, 0, 0.04),
|
||||||
0px 0px 1px rgba(0, 0, 0, 0.04);
|
0px 0px 1px rgba(0, 0, 0, 0.04);
|
||||||
}
|
}
|
||||||
|
|
||||||
[data-scheme="light"] {
|
|
||||||
--pre-text-color: #272822;
|
|
||||||
--pre-background-color: #fafafa;
|
|
||||||
@import "partials/highlight/light.scss";
|
|
||||||
}
|
|
||||||
|
|
||||||
[data-scheme="dark"] {
|
|
||||||
--pre-text-color: #f8f8f2;
|
|
||||||
--pre-background-color: #272822;
|
|
||||||
@import "partials/highlight/dark.scss";
|
|
||||||
|
|
||||||
/*
|
|
||||||
* Global style
|
|
||||||
*/
|
|
||||||
--body-background: #303030;
|
|
||||||
--accent-color: #ecf0f1;
|
|
||||||
--accent-color-darker: #bdc3c7;
|
|
||||||
--accent-color-text: #000;
|
|
||||||
--body-text-color: rgba(255, 255, 255, 0.7);
|
|
||||||
--scrollbar-thumb: hsl(0, 0%, 30%);
|
|
||||||
--scrollbar-track: var(--body-background);
|
|
||||||
|
|
||||||
/*
|
|
||||||
* Card style
|
|
||||||
*/
|
|
||||||
--card-background: #424242;
|
|
||||||
--card-background-selected: rgba(255, 255, 255, 0.16);
|
|
||||||
--card-text-color-main: rgba(255, 255, 255, 0.9);
|
|
||||||
--card-text-color-secondary: rgba(255, 255, 255, 0.7);
|
|
||||||
--card-text-color-tertiary: rgba(255, 255, 255, 0.5);
|
|
||||||
--card-separator-color: rgba(255, 255, 255, 0.12);
|
|
||||||
|
|
||||||
/*
|
|
||||||
* Article content style
|
|
||||||
*/
|
|
||||||
--code-background-color: #272822;
|
|
||||||
--code-text-color: rgba(255, 255, 255, 0.9);
|
|
||||||
|
|
||||||
--table-border-color: #717171;
|
|
||||||
--tr-even-background-color: #545454;
|
|
||||||
|
|
||||||
--blockquote-background-color: rgb(75 75 75);
|
|
||||||
}
|
|
||||||
|
Loading…
Reference in New Issue
Block a user